2. Culinary Delights: Savor Authentic Gili Air Cuisine

2. Culinary Delights: Savor Authentic Gili Air Cuisine

Indonesia2010 114, CC BY-NC-ND 2.0, via Flickr

No journey to Gili Air is complete without indulging in its authentic cuisine. The island’s culinary scene showcases a delightful mix of flavors influenced by Indonesian traditions. For instance, dishes like Nasi Campur and Ayam Betutu utilize fresh ingredients sourced locally, ensuring a unique dining experience.

Additionally, street food stalls serve delicious snacks like Sate Lilit, a mouthwatering fish satay, which you must try. Transitioning from tasting to cooking, consider joining a cooking class to immerse yourself even deeper into Gili Air culture. By doing so, you’ll gain valuable insights into the island’s culinary heritage.

3. Discover the Art of Ikat Weaving: A Local Craft

3. Discover the Art of Ikat Weaving: A Local Craft

Boat Bite, Indonesia 2010, CC BY-NC-ND 2.0, via Flickr

The art of Ikat weaving is a significant aspect of Gili Air culture. This intricate textile art is created using a unique dyeing technique that binds the yarns before weaving, allowing for breathtaking patterns. When you visit local workshops, you can observe artisans passionately crafting these textiles, which are not only beautiful but also carry cultural significance.

Furthermore, you may even have the opportunity to try your hand at this artistic process. Engaging in Ikat weaving provides a deeper understanding of the island’s traditions, making it a memorable experience. Overall, appreciating and learning about this craft will enhance your journey on Gili Air.

6. Celebrate Galungan: The Island’s Hindu Festival

One of the most significant Events in Gili Air’s calendar is the Galungan Festival, a vibrant celebration of the Hindu faith. This occasion occurs every 210 days, marking the victory of good over evil. During this festival, the island transforms, with intricate penjor decorations adorning the streets.

Visitors can enhance their experience by participating in various ceremonies. Engaging with local communities during Galungan provides a deeper understanding of their beliefs and values. Furthermore, every family holds rituals in their homes, inviting you to witness the rich tapestry of traditions.

Additionally, local markets come alive with special foods and offerings during this period. Be sure to try some traditional delicacies while experiencing the captivating atmosphere. This celebration reflects the vibrant Gili Air culture, highlighting the islanders’ spiritual connection and community spirit.
